Nara, Japan

A friendly deer strolls along a path in Nara Park, where these creatures roam freely among locals and tourists. Nara Park is famous for its population of free-roaming deer, considered to be messengers of the gods in the Shinto religion. Visitors can purchase special crackers to feed the deer, which have become accustomed to human interaction. The park is located in Nara, a city known for its historical sites and temples.
